Questões de Noções de Informática - Software para Concurso

Foram encontradas 2.407 questões

Q2895442 Arquitetura de Software

Dentre as opções a seguir, marque aquela que contém um princípio que NÃO está de acordo com os princípios definidos pela Aliança Ágil no contexto de processos de software.

Alternativas
Q2895437 Arquitetura de Software

Sejam as seguintes assertivas sobre programação orientadas a objetos:


I. O polimorfismo é a capacidade de um tipo A aparecer, ou ser usado, como outro tipo B . Em linguagens fortemente tipadas, como Java A, deve ser derivado do tipo ou implementar uma interface que representa o tipo B.

II. Para implementar o polimorfismo, utiliza-se uma técnica chamada de amarração antecipada, onde a chamada de um método é resolvida em tempo de compilação/linkedição.

III. Sobrecarga de método é capacidade de métodos distintos de uma mesma classe possuírem o mesmo nome, mas parâmetros diferentes.


Marque a alternativa correta em relação às assertivas acima.

Alternativas
Q2895434 Arquitetura de Software

Marque a opção que contém uma assertiva verdadeira sobre a linguagem C++.

Alternativas
Q2895433 Arquitetura de Software

Seja a seguinte declaração, escrita na linguagem Java:


public final class CL

{

}


Nesta declaração, o uso do modificador final significa que:

Alternativas
Q2895431 Arquitetura de Software

Sejam as seguintes assertivas sobre a o conceito de interface (palavra chave interface) na linguagem Java:


I. Não é permitido definir o corpo (implementação) de um método em uma interface.

II. Não é permitido o uso do modificador private na declaração de um campo de uma interface.

III. Não é permitido o uso do modificador static na declaração de um campo de uma interface.


Marque a alternativa correta em relação às assertivas acima.

Alternativas
Respostas
361: A
362: B
363: E
364: C
365: A